It is an ANSI A118.6 polymer modified, cement-based non-sanded grout designed for highly glazed or polished tile, marble and natural stone that would be scratched by sanded grouts. By sealing your grout, you get to prolong your tile surfaces lifespan and minimize damage to a considerable extent. When grout is not sealed in time, grime and water can seep into it, causing cracks on your tiles and forcing them to break at a certain point. Any benefits that a specific premixed product might advertise (sealant additives, color options, anti-efflorescence guarantees, etc etc) can also be found in a dry grout mix. It is now an ANSI A118.7 polymer-modified, cement-based sanded grout that produces hard, dense joints that resist shrinking, cracking, and wear.
